Great Sound Quality, Ergonomics lacking

Aug 19, 2013

I'm an acoustics professional with a pro audio background, and after much research and comparative listening, the ER-4's are the clear winner on the IEM market. The frequency balance is as close to flat as I've found in an IEM and compares favorably to my reference headphones and loudspeakers including HD650's and Focal monitors. The soundstage, isolation, and dynamics are as good as more expensive IEM's I've tried. The only drawback is the physi... Show More

Real enjoyment.

Sep 18, 2015

Excellent balanced sound. As usual : best sound with good source and good headphone amp. That's the best earbuds i've ever owned compared to high end models (Grado GR10: harsh sound even after a long break in, Senheiser Momentum in-ear not balanced: too much bass and less refined sound. I use ER-4PT with M2TECH Hiface DAC, the EXCELLENT GRADO HEADPHONE AMP RA1(battery powered is the best) and Iphone or Mac: wonderful sound, wide, balanced, precise, natural.
